Precautions Before using insulin regular, tell your doctor or pharmacist if you are allergic to it; or to other insulins; or … Hypoglycemia is the most common and serious side effect of insulin, occurring in approximately 16% of type 1 and 10% of type II diabetic patients (the incidence varies greatly depending on the populations studied, types of insulin therapy, etc). Although there are counterregulatory endocrinologic responses to … See more Permanent neuropsychological impairment has been associated with recurrent episodes of severe hypoglycemia.
